The 2026 edition of the Indian Premier League (IPL) is moving into its crucial build-up phase: the player auction is scheduled for 16 December 2025 in Abu Dhabi, marking the third straight overseas auction for the league.
Today, 15 November 2025, marks the deadline for all ten franchises to submit their lists of retained and released players — a key milestone ahead of the auction.

What this means & what’s next
With today’s deadline passing (15 Nov), all franchises should have locked in their retention/release lists. That sets the stage for the IPL aucti on 16 December in Abu Dhabi, where teams will pick up players from the pool of released names, and from unregistered talent, to finalise their 2026 rosters.
